TNT Update
Posted on Tuesday, March 25, 2008 at 5:16 PM by David Zavadil
The first week of November I began the TNT workout. My goal was to lose weight and lower my cholesterol. Yesterday I had my blood work done. I have officially a net loss of 17.5 pounds, according to my records. I said net loss becuase I have built some muscle, adding some weight. The more exciting new was that my cholesterol came down drastically. My total numbers went down from 217 to 178 and my ratio went from 5.2 to 3.7. While I realize that most who read this will go, "Huh?" Trust me, this is good news.
